BlogJak przygotować firmę do KSeF - praktyczny checklist
Poradnik

Jak przygotować firmę do KSeF - praktyczny checklist

·6 min czytania·KsefAlert

Gdzie powinieneś być w marcu 2026 r.

Etap 1 KSeF jest aktywny od 1 lutego 2026 r. Oznacza to, że od ponad miesiąca każdy czynny podatnik VAT ma obowiązek odbierać faktury zakupowe z KSeF. Jeśli Twój kontrahent wystawił fakturę w systemie, ona tam jest - niezależnie od tego, czy ją sprawdziłeś.

Etap 2 - obowiązek wystawiania faktur w KSeF dla wszystkich pozostałych podatników - wchodzi 1 kwietnia 2026 r. To niecałe dwa miesiące. Firmy, które nie zakończyły jeszcze wdrożenia, mają konkretny deadline i konkretną listę rzeczy do zrobienia.

Poniżej znajdziesz szczegółowy checklist - podzielony na to, co powinno być już gotowe, i to, co musisz wdrożyć przed 1 kwietnia.

Co powinno być już gotowe (Etap 1 - od 1 lutego)

Dostęp do KSeF i odbieranie faktur

Podstawowy warunek Etapu 1 to możliwość odbierania faktur z systemu. Żeby to działało, musisz mieć:

  • Konto w KSeF - zakładane na ksef.podatki.gov.pl przez Profil Zaufany, podpis kwalifikowany lub pieczęć elektroniczną (dla firm).
  • Token autoryzacyjny lub certyfikat - potrzebny do integracji z programem do fakturowania i narzędziami monitorującymi. Token generujesz w Module Certyfikatów i Uprawnień. Szczegółowa instrukcja w artykule Jak wygenerować token KSeF.
  • Skonfigurowany monitoring faktur przychodzących - KSeF nie wysyła żadnych powiadomień. Faktury czekają w systemie, dopóki ich nie pobierzesz lub nie uruchomisz narzędzia, które robi to automatycznie.

Jeśli któregoś z powyższych brakuje - zacznij od tego, zanim przejdziesz dalej.

Checklist przed 1 kwietnia 2026 r.

1. Audyt obecnego procesu fakturowania

Zanim zaczniesz konfigurować integrację, zrób krótki przegląd tego, jak wygląda fakturowanie w Twojej firmie dziś.

  • Jakich programów lub narzędzi używasz do wystawiania faktur? (program księgowy, platforma online, Excel, Word?)
  • Ile faktur wystawiasz miesięcznie i w ilu różnych systemach?
  • Czy masz faktury cykliczne lub szablony, które trzeba będzie przenieść?
  • Kto w firmie wystawia faktury - jedna osoba, dział, czy kilka osób rozproszonych?

To ważne pytania, bo integracja z KSeF dotyczy każdego miejsca, w którym w firmie powstają faktury. Jeśli masz dwa programy i oba wystawiają faktury, oba muszą być zintegrowane z KSeF.

2. Sprawdzenie gotowości programu do fakturowania

Nie każde oprogramowanie obsługuje KSeF 2.0 - upewnij się, że Twoje narzędzie:

  • Generuje faktury w formacie XML zgodnym ze schematem FA(3) opublikowanym przez Ministerstwo Finansów.
  • Wysyła faktury do KSeF przez API (nie tylko eksportuje XML do ręcznego wgrania).
  • Obsługuje tryb offline - czyli możliwość wystawienia faktury lokalnie podczas awarii i późniejszego przesłania jej do KSeF.
  • Jest zaktualizowane do najnowszej wersji z obsługą KSeF 2.0 (nie tylko wcześniejszego API).

Większość popularnych programów - inFakt, Fakturownia, wFirma, iFirma, Comarch ERP, Symfonia, enova365 - oferuje już integrację, ale zwykle wymaga aktywacji lub konfiguracji w ustawieniach. Jeśli korzystasz z mniej popularnego rozwiązania lub systemu własnego, sprawdź u dostawcy aktualny status integracji.

3. Konfiguracja wystawiania faktur w KSeF

  • Podłącz program do fakturowania do KSeF, podając token autoryzacyjny lub certyfikat.
  • Przetestuj wystawienie faktury w środowisku testowym KSeF (dostępnym na ksef.podatki.gov.pl). Środowisko testowe jest bezpłatne i nie generuje żadnych prawdziwych dokumentów - można bezpiecznie sprawdzić, czy faktury przechodzą walidację.
  • Zweryfikuj, że faktura po przesłaniu otrzymuje numer KSeF i pojawia się na koncie.
  • Sprawdź faktury z różnymi stawkami VAT, fakturę zaliczkową i fakturę korygującą - to dokumenty, które najczęściej sprawiają problemy przy walidacji.

4. Konfiguracja odbierania i importu faktur kosztowych

  • Ustal w firmie procedurę: kto odpowiada za pobieranie faktur kosztowych z KSeF, jak często i do jakiego systemu je importuje.
  • Przetestuj import faktur XML z KSeF do programu księgowego - większość systemów obsługuje to automatycznie, ale warto sprawdzić czy dane (NIP, kwoty, daty) wczytują się poprawnie.
  • Skonfiguruj monitoring faktur przychodzących. Ręczne logowanie do portalu KSeF codziennie jest nieefektywne i podatne na błędy. KsefAlert automatycznie sprawdza konto KSeF i wysyła powiadomienie email lub SMS przy każdej nowej fakturze kosztowej - dzięki temu żaden dokument nie czeka niezauważony.

5. Procedura na wypadek awarii (tryb offline)

  • Sprawdź, czy Twój program do fakturowania obsługuje tryb offline zgodny z wymaganiami KSeF 2.0.
  • Przygotuj krótką procedurę: jak pracownik powinien postąpić, gdy system KSeF jest niedostępny? Kto decyduje o przejściu na tryb offline? W jakim terminie trzeba przesłać faktury offline do KSeF po ustaniu awarii?
  • Przetestuj wystawienie faktury offline i jej późniejsze przesłanie do systemu.

Brak gotowej procedury offline to jeden z najczęstszych błędów przy wdrożeniu. Awaria KSeF w środku miesiąca, gdy nikt w firmie nie wie co robić, to scenariusz, którego warto uniknąć.

6. Szkolenie zespołu

  • Przeszkol wszystkich pracowników, którzy wystawiają faktury, z nowego procesu.
  • Upewnij się, że znają procedurę offline.
  • Jeśli korzystasz z biura rachunkowego - poinformuj je o konfiguracji i ustal, kto odpowiada za monitoring faktur przychodzących: Ty czy biuro.

Najczęstsze problemy i jak ich uniknąć

Program obsługuje KSeF, ale nie KSeF 2.0 Starsze wersje programów miały integrację z KSeF 1.0, które od września 2025 r. jest wygaszone. Upewnij się, że Twój dostawca zaktualizował integrację do nowego API - inaczej faktury będą odrzucane przez system.

Faktura przechodzi w programie, ale jest odrzucana przez KSeF Najczęstsze przyczyny: nieprawidłowy format daty, brakujące pole wymagane przez schemat FA(3), błąd w NIP kontrahenta lub nieprawidłowy kod GTU. Środowisko testowe KSeF zwraca komunikaty błędów z dokładnym opisem problemu - warto przejść przez nie przed 1 kwietnia.

Zapomnienie o fakturach przychodzących Obowiązek odbierania faktur obowiązuje od 1 lutego, a wiele firm wciąż nie ma ustawionego żadnego procesu ich pobierania. Faktura wystawiona przez kontrahenta w KSeF jest uznana za doręczoną z chwilą jej wystawienia - Twój brak wiedzy o jej istnieniu nie zwalnia z obowiązku rozliczenia.

Jeden token dla wszystkich systemów Jeśli masz kilka systemów lub narzędzi korzystających z KSeF (program do fakturowania, program księgowy, narzędzie monitorujące), rozważ wygenerowanie osobnych tokenów z odpowiednimi zakresami uprawnień. Ułatwia to zarządzanie dostępami i ogranicza ryzyko w razie kompromitacji jednego tokenu.

Ile czasu potrzebujesz

Orientacyjny czas wdrożenia zależy od złożoności procesów w firmie:

Typ firmyOrientacyjny czas wdrożenia
JDG z jednym programem do fakturowania3-5 dni roboczych
Mała firma (do 10 osób)1-2 tygodnie
Średnia firma (do 50 osób)2-4 tygodnie
Duża firma lub kilka systemów1-3 miesiące

Powyższe szacunki zakładają, że program do fakturowania obsługuje KSeF i nie wymaga wymiany. Jeśli musisz zmieniać oprogramowanie, doliczy się czas migracji danych i nauki nowego narzędzia.

Jeśli zostawiłeś wdrożenie na ostatnią chwilę

Masz niecałe dwa miesiące. To realny czas na wdrożenie dla JDG i małych firm - pod warunkiem, że zaczniesz teraz.

Priorytetyzuj w tej kolejności: najpierw token i dostęp do KSeF, potem monitoring faktur przychodzących (obowiązek już trwa), na końcu konfiguracja wystawiania i testy. Rok 2026 jest wolny od kar - możesz popełniać błędy bez finansowych konsekwencji, ale warto je wykryć w środowisku testowym, a nie na żywych fakturach.


Źródła:

Nie przegap żadnej faktury w KSeF

KsefAlert monitoruje Twoje konto KSeF 24/7 i wysyła powiadomienie email lub SMS gdy pojawi się nowa faktura kosztowa. Konfiguracja zajmuje 2 minuty.

Dowiedz się więcej